Primrose is an associate in the London office, and is part of the International Arbitration and Construction and Engineering groups.

She has acted for clients in construction disputes relating to commercial developments, infrastructure and energy projects.

Primrose joined White & Case in 2021 from another leading international law firm.

Experience

Advising an employer in respect of claims and disputes arising from an LNG export facility in North America.

Advising an employer on a dispute with its sub-contractor relating to an LNG production facility in Europe.

Advising a Korean contractor on disputes with its consortium parties on a health facility in Singapore.

Representing a Japanese and Korean joint venture in ICC arbitration concerning an oil refinery in the Middle East.*

Advising an independent certifier on a dispute relating to a waste-to-energy plant.*

Advising a global engineering, construction and services company in a dispute against a state-owned multinational corporation in relation to an ammonia plant.*

Acting for a multinational company in an adjudication against its main contractor arising from delay to the construction of its headquarters and research facility.*

Acting for a Japanese contractor in an ICC arbitration concerning a pulp mill in Vietnam.*

 

*Matters worked on prior to joining White & Case
